Output fdab067baebe2c2c8799cb7db45cd2c166b68acc03e84a0faad7d92beb7a9f4a:2

value
2188356
script pubkey
OP_0 OP_PUSHBYTES_20 75e9c5d8305ad7272314ca02e4ad3d5e06df463d
address
bc1qwh5utkpstttjwgc5egpwftfatcrd733ast0ytw
transaction
fdab067baebe2c2c8799cb7db45cd2c166b68acc03e84a0faad7d92beb7a9f4a
confirmations
106701
spent
true